I have been working with a new ELRS system.  I'm using a RadioMaster TX15 transmitter and several RadioMaster receivers.  I got an 8-channel ER8GV receiver that I want to put into my sailplane that currently has an RFU and X10+v1.

To begin I configured an X10+v2 to take SBUS as its input.

Then I configured one of the PWM servo outputs on the ER8GV receiver to be a serial port and to output SBUS.  I connected it all up and powered on and it worked.

The X10+v2 green led flickered about three times per second.

I got feedback from the RCGroups ELRS forum that the SBUS errors are there because ELRS periodically sends back telemetry packets in time slots normally occupied by control packets.  My system's overall packet rate is 100Hz for 10ms frames and my telemetry ratio is 1:32.  That means it sends about three telemetry packets every second.  That could explain the three led flickers pre second.

My ELRS frame rate is set to 10ms and the receiver's PWM outputs are set to 50Hz.  The ELRS system therefore sends every other control packet to the PWM outputs.

The setup and servos seem to work, so I plan to try it out at the airfield soon.
